A little over a week ago Wendy Williams alarmed many when she canceled a week of  Wendy with no apparent explanation, four months after fainting live on television. Days later the talk show host revealed she was battling flu-like symptoms. Watch below.

Now the 53-year-old has finally announced what’s really been going on with her health. She has been diagnosed with Graves’ disease and effective Thursday, Wendy will go on a three-week hiatus.

So what is Graves’ disease exactly? According to the Mayo Clinic, it is an immune system disorder that results in the overproduction of thyroid hormones. Symptoms include anxiety and irritability, tremors in your hands or fingers and weight loss, despite normal eating habits.

Although a serious diagnosis. Williams promises to return. She also told CNN she will not have a fill-in host and the show will rerun old episodes during her absence.
